On average, the study participants reported using digital media an average of 10 hours and four minutes <em>per day<\/em>, on such entertainment activities as social media, video chat, texting, shopping, and gaming.<\/p>\n<p>That\u2019s a total of <em>70 hours per week <\/em>spent online, approximately double the average time spent in school. If teens were suddenly banned from screen time, they could use the time freed from solely that to instead hold down both a full-time <em>and<\/em> a part-time job. Some of this average may include multitasking, such as texting while scrolling Instagram, the study said, but this total of 70 hours per week spent on screens also did <em>not<\/em> include time spent watching TV.<\/p>\n<p> Low-Class Behavior Rampant in Middle Class <\/p>\n<p>The researchers say their Institute for Family Studies and Wheatley Institute study is the first to examine the effects of family structure on young people\u2019s screen time. They found that teens living with their own biological and married parents still spent an astonishing amount of time on screens, at an average of nine hours per day. Still, that was nearly two hours fewer per day, on average, than children living without a biological parent, who spent an average of 11 hours per day online.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e adolescents most likely to be depressed, lonely, and dissatisfied with life are heavy digital media users in stepparent, single-parent, or other non-intact families,\u201d write study authors Twenge, Wendy Wang, Jenet Erickson, and Brad Wilcox. \u201cThe link between excessive technology use and poor mental health is larger for youth in non-intact families compared to those in intact families.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>So, according to this study\u2019s findings, children in intact families spend an average of 63 hours per week amusing themselves online, while children in broken families spend an average of 77 hours per week amusing themselves online. The study discovered \u201cespecially large differences by family structure in youth time spent on gaming and texting. For example, youth in stepfamilies report spending about 50 minutes a day more texting than youth in intact families.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Other studies on children\u2019s screen use <a href=\"https:\/\/www.commonsensemedia.org\/research\/the-common-sense-census-media-use-by-tweens-and-teens-2021\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">reinforce<\/a> this finding \u2014 that America\u2019s young people are wasting almost all of their waking free time on entertainment instead of personal growth or service to others. As this IFS\/Wheatley study points out, this shift has happened extremely quickly, and it\u2019s not all because of the 2020-2022 Covid lockdowns that also <a href=\"https:\/\/www.aei.org\/articles\/no-surprise-were-not-going-to-remedy-massive-education-loss-from-the-pandemic-sorry-kids\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">arrested<\/a> American children\u2019s development. Between 2009 and 2017, \u201cthe time high school students spent online doubled.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The study points out that high screen time for adolescents is correlated with depression, loneliness, lack of sleep, and negative body image.
